在内容生态日益庞大的数字化时代,高效管理网站标签体系成为提升内容可检索性与用户体验的关键环节。面对数千篇存留历史标签关联的文章,手动逐篇调整不仅耗时耗力,更易产生人为疏漏。如何通过系统化方案实现旧标签的批量迁移与重构,已成为内容运营者的必修课题。
插件工具批量处理
对于非技术背景的运营人员,插件是实现标签批量管理的首选方案。如Batch Cat插件允许用户按分类筛选文章后,通过"转移文章到选中类目"功能实现标签迁移,其操作逻辑与Excel筛选替换类似,可视化界面降低了操作门槛。而Term Management Tools插件则提供标签合并功能,将"甜点"与"点心"合并为"甜品"时,原标签下的文章自动继承新标签,同时处理旧标签的SEO重定向,避免产生404错误。
部分插件还支持正则表达式替换,如Better Search Replace可对文章内容中的标签关键词进行深度清洗。测试数据显示,该插件在替换包含HTML结构的复合标签时,准确率达到98.7%,避免传统字符串替换可能导致的页面结构破坏。不过需注意插件兼容性问题,2024年WordPress核心更新后,约12%的批量编辑插件出现功能失效,建议优先选择持续维护的开源项目。
数据库直接操作
通过phpMyAdmin执行SQL指令,可精准控制标签关联关系的迁移过程。核心原理在于修改wp_term_relationships表中的term_taxonomy_id字段,将其指向新标签的ID值。典型操作包含三个步骤:备份全库防止误操作;执行UPDATE语句关联新旧标签ID;清理wp_term_taxonomy表中未被引用的旧标签记录。
实战案例显示,对含50万篇文章的电商站点进行标签迁移时,SQL方案的执行效率比插件方案快3.5倍。但需特别注意数据库字符集问题,2025年某技术社区案例中,因UTF-8与UTF8mb4编码差异导致23%的标签关联丢失。建议在执行前使用SELECT语句抽样验证查询条件,并通过LIMIT参数分批次处理超大规模数据集。
代码脚本定制开发
开发人员可通过WP_Query构建定制化标签处理逻辑,结合wp_update_post函数实现精准替换。例如创建指定时间范围内的文章集合,遍历时动态检测标签使用频率,自动将低频标签迁移至预设的标准标签。这种方案特别适用于需要结合业务规则(如季节性标签轮换)的复杂场景。
某媒体网站的技术白皮书披露,其开发的标签迁移系统包含智能合并模块:当检测到新旧标签语义相似度超过85%时,自动触发合并流程并生成变更日志。该系统采用NLP技术分析标签语义,相比传统关键词匹配方式,误操作率降低62%。但需注意避免过度自动化,建议保留人工审核环节,防止算法误判引发的语义偏移。

内容生态协同优化
标签迁移不应是孤立操作,而需与整体内容策略协同。SEO分析工具显示,批量修改标签后,网站的内部链接密度平均波动幅度达37%,需同步调整导航结构与关联推荐逻辑。某旅游网站案例表明,在将"自驾游"标签升级为"户外旅行"后,配合专题聚合页改造,该标签页的跳出率从68%降至41%,平均停留时长增长2.3倍。
历史数据分析表明,标签体系的更新周期与内容增长率呈正相关。建议建立标签生命周期管理机制,当某标签下文章超过2000篇或年增长率低于5%时,触发标签拆分或合并流程。同时引入标签权重算法,动态调节其在导航中的展示优先级,避免信息过载。
插件下载说明
未提供下载提取码的插件,都是站长辛苦开发!需要的请联系本站客服或者站长!
织梦二次开发QQ群
本站客服QQ号:862782808(点击左边QQ号交流),群号(383578617)
如果您有任何织梦问题,请把问题发到群里,阁主将为您写解决教程!
转载请注明: 织梦模板 » 如何批量修改WordPress文章中的旧标签关联关系































